2.3 General Wiring Diagram (For Enhanced E & G type)
The following is the standard wiring diagram for the F510 inverter (◎ indicates main
circuit terminals and ○ indicates control circuit terminals ). Locations and symbols of the
wiring terminal block might be different due to different models of F510. The description of
control circuit terminals and main circuit terminals can be referred to Table 2.1, 2.2 and 2.3
Remarks:
*1: Models IP20 200V 1~30HP, 400V 1~40HP have a built-in braking transistor so that the braking resistor can be connected
between terminal B1 and B2.
*2: The multi-function digital input terminals S1~S6 can be set to Source (PNP) or Sink (NPN) mode via SW6.
*3: Use SW3/SW4 to switch between voltage (0~10V) and current (4~20mA) input for Multi-function analog input 2 (AI2).
Besides please also check parameter 04-00 for proper setting.
*4: Run permissive input SF1 & SF2 is a normally closed input. This input should be closed to enable the inverter output. To
activate this input, open the link between SF1/ SF2 and SG.
*5: When using the open collector for pulse input, it doesn’t need resistance because of built-in pull-up resistance.
*6: AO1 / AO2 default setting is 0~+10V.
*7: It need turn on the switch for the terminal resistor RS485 in the last inverter when many inverters in parallel connection.
*8: Only the models IP20 200V 5~50HP amd 400V 5~100HP provide P1 and P2 terminal, for external DCL, connected
between P1 and P2. P1 and P2 are short-circuited before shipping out from the factory.
*9: 200V 60~175HP and 400V 125~425HP have built-in DC reactors.
